Output 353b0520d7f90d198eb312b3ace8f1218f941d898e0af5943374005b3eaa4c69:1

value
104844353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 855f996799f434f4f4521f40feeed70f33c99c01 OP_EQUAL
address
3DrEKQevHNhW6gQwktLrPkH38KgVJskF3T
transaction
353b0520d7f90d198eb312b3ace8f1218f941d898e0af5943374005b3eaa4c69
spent
true